大数据时代已经到来。网络大数据测试作为大数据领域的重要分支,对数据质量、数据分析和数据应用等方面提出了更高的要求。本文将从网络大数据测试的背景、意义、方法及发展趋势等方面进行探讨,以期为我国大数据产业发展提供有益的参考。
一、网络大数据测试的背景与意义
1. 背景介绍
网络大数据测试是指在互联网环境下,对大规模、多类型、高速增长的数据进行质量、性能和安全性等方面的测试。随着我国大数据产业的快速发展,网络大数据测试已成为企业、政府和科研机构等各个领域关注的焦点。
2. 意义
(1)保障数据质量:网络大数据测试有助于发现数据中的错误、异常和缺失等问题,提高数据质量,为后续的数据分析和应用提供可靠的数据基础。
(2)优化系统性能:通过对网络大数据进行测试,可以发现系统中的瓶颈和不足,从而优化系统性能,提高数据处理能力。
(3)提高数据安全性:网络大数据测试有助于发现数据安全隐患,提升数据安全防护能力,降低数据泄露风险。
(4)推动产业创新:网络大数据测试为大数据应用提供技术支撑,有助于推动大数据在各领域的创新应用。
二、网络大数据测试的方法与关键技术
1. 方法
(1)数据采集与预处理:通过网络爬虫、API接口等方式采集数据,并进行清洗、去重、归一化等预处理操作。
(2)数据质量检测:对采集到的数据进行完整性、一致性、准确性等方面的检测。
(3)性能测试:通过压力测试、负载测试等方法,评估系统在处理大数据时的性能表现。
(4)安全性测试:对数据传输、存储和访问等环节进行安全性测试,确保数据安全。
2. 关键技术
(1)分布式测试:针对大规模数据,采用分布式测试技术,提高测试效率和覆盖范围。
(2)自动化测试:利用自动化测试工具,实现测试流程的自动化,提高测试效率。
(3)可视化分析:通过数据可视化技术,直观展示测试结果,便于发现问题和定位原因。
(4)机器学习与人工智能:利用机器学习和人工智能技术,提高测试的智能化水平。
三、网络大数据测试的发展趋势
1. 测试技术融合:网络大数据测试将与其他测试技术(如软件测试、性能测试等)相互融合,形成更加完善的测试体系。
2. 人工智能赋能:人工智能技术将在网络大数据测试中得到广泛应用,实现测试流程的自动化和智能化。
3. 安全测试重视:随着数据安全问题的日益突出,网络大数据测试将更加注重安全性测试,保障数据安全。
4. 跨领域应用:网络大数据测试将在金融、医疗、教育等各个领域得到广泛应用,推动大数据产业创新发展。
网络大数据测试作为大数据领域的重要分支,对数据质量、性能和安全性等方面提出了更高的要求。随着技术的不断进步,网络大数据测试将朝着更加智能化、自动化和安全化的方向发展,为我国大数据产业发展提供有力支撑。